14:22 — Offline sync regression confirmed (Terrapath field-survey app)

At 14:22 the on-call engineer reproduced the data-loss path: surveys saved while offline were marked synced once connectivity returned, even when the upload was rejected. The queue flush skipped the server acknowledgement check introduced in the previous sprint. Release manager note: the fix must ship before the coastal survey season. The offending build is identified by the token recorded below.

session token of kawif-fawig = htk31_f3f599be2b1a34affb1efa8d0feccf8

## Changelog — stringsift v3.0.0

Changed defaults in the translation-string extraction script. Extraction now scans template files by default, not just source modules, which previously caused silent gaps in catalogs. Duplicate keys are now an error rather than a warning, and output is sorted deterministically so diffs stay reviewable. Projects relying on the old lenient behavior must opt out explicitly. Future maintainers should note these defaults are enforced at startup; the script currently ships with the configuration values listed below.

settings of fadup-kajog:
[casox]
port = 3000
team = jorix
host = casox.paliqio.example
region = lower-4
access_code = ac_dd069a
timeout_ms = 750

Subject: Calendar sync conflict in Friday's release window

Team, the Orbitwell scheduler double-booked the deploy slot against the Fenley maintenance freeze. We've moved the cutover to the later window and confirmed no overlap with the audit scan. Permissions on the shared calendar were unchanged; only event ownership shifted. For verification, the relevant trace token is below.

trace token, tawip-hahop: htk3_cb5